The Winespectator: 91/100 PointsLush and rich, with layered fig paste, crushed plum and dark blueberry fruit mingling with extra licorice snap and dark chocolate notes. Rich, but not overbearing. Nicely embedded acidity carries the finish. Drink now through 2011. Robert Parker: 89/100 PointsVintage 2007: The purple-colored 2007 Malbec Estate spent 18 months in French oak, 20% new. It has an excellent bouquet of lavender, spice box, black cherry, and black raspberry. Ripe and full-bodied on the palate, it has plenty of spicy, savory black fruit, good balance, and a lengthy, fruit-filled finish. Give it 2-3 years and drink it from 2011 to 2019. The WinemakerThe Wine Enthusiast: 89/100 PointsA typically huge Colomé wine with initial damp, murky, funky aromas that give way to earth, roasted fruit and compost. Fortunately it's fresher in the mouth, and the wine definitely improves with airing. Still, the palate is big and oily, with roasted berry, herb and wild, exotic flavors.
